Step1: Find critical points
Set \((x - 3)(x + 8)=0\), so \(x = 3\) or \(x=-8\). These divide the number line into intervals: \((-\infty,-8)\), \((-8,3)\), \((3,\infty)\).
Step2: Test intervals
- For \(x < -8\) (e.g., \(x=-10\)): \((-10 - 3)(-10 + 8)=(-13)(-2)=26>0\), so \(x=-10\) satisfies \((x - 3)(x + 8)>0\).
- For \(-8 < x < 3\) (e.g., \(x = 0\)): \((0 - 3)(0 + 8)=(-3)(8)=-24<0\), so \(x = 0\) does not satisfy.
- For \(x > 3\) (e.g., \(x = 4\)): \((4 - 3)(4 + 8)=(1)(12)=12>0\), but we check given options. Among options, \(x=-10\) is in the first interval.
Step1: Square both sides
Given \(\sqrt{4x - 3}=5\), square both sides: \(4x - 3 = 25\).
Step2: Solve for \(x\)
Add 3 to both sides: \(4x=28\), then divide by 4: \(x = 7\).
